How Our Sprinkler System Water Damage Restoration Service Actually Works
When you call us, our team will quickly dispatch a technician to your location to assess the damage and provide a detailed report. We’ll then work with you to develop a customized restoration plan, which may include:
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Identify the source of the leak and contain the damage to prevent further water intrusion. Our technicians will use specialized equipment to detect hidden moisture and prevent further dam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Remove excess water from your home using powerful pumps and dry the affected area using specialized drying equipment.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Monitor moisture levels using advanced moisture meters and dehumidify the air to prevent mold growth and ensure your home is completely dry.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Thoroughly clean and sanitize all affected areas, including walls, floors, and personal belongings, to prevent the growth of mold and mildew.
Step 5: Restoration and Repair
Repair any damaged structures including walls, floors, and ceilings, and replace any damaged materials to ensure your home is safe and secure.

Warning Signs You Need Sprinkler System Water Damage Restoration
Ignoring the warning signs of a sprinkler system leak can lead to costly repairs and even health risks. Here are some common war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Unpleasant odors can be a sign of hidden moisture and mold growth. If you notice a persistent musty smell, it’s time to call us.
Water Stains on Ceilings and Walls
Visible water stains can show a leak in your sprinkler system. Don’t ignore these signs, as they can lead to further damage and costly repairs.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any changes in your flooring, it’s time to call us.
Increased Energy Bills
Unusually high energy bills can be a sign of a leak in your sprinkler system. If you notice a spike in your energy bills, it’s time to investigate further.
Visible Water Leaks
Visible water leaks are a clear sign of a problem. If you notice water pooling around the base of your sprinkler head or dripping from the head itself, it’s time to call us.

Sprinkler System Water Damage Restoration Cost In Dayton, MN
The cost of Sprinkler System Water Damage Restoration in Dayton, MN can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Containment |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the complexity of the containment process. |
| Water Extraction and Drying | $1,000 – $5,000 | The amount of water extracted and the time required for drying. |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| The extent of the cleaning and sanitizing required. |
| Restoration and Repair | $2,000 – $10,000 | The extent of the damage and the materials required for repair. |
